In Kamikaze Lassplanes, you play as a pilot of a military aircraft, in a steampunk universe. You\u2019ve been assigned to a giant floating fortress, and then partnered with a Lassplane: A woman that is also a fighter jet. You need to, uh, control her and, uh, press her buttons so you can fight back against some threat or another.<\/p>\n<p>The visual novel side of things plays out like a typical romance visual novel where a guy is chasing after a harem of skirts. Except in this particular case there are just the two women\/warplanes to chase after. Both get plenty of screentime and have distinct personalities, so chances are that you\u2019ll be drawn to one of them. Or just their assets. Did I say this game has a lot of fan service in it.<\/p>\n<p>As a visual novel, Kamikaze Lassplanes has it all. Eight possible endings based on choices you make as you play round out a pretty lengthy offering. Sure the narrative itself is pretty mundane, but it bubbles along well enough to get its point across. What really makes the game distinctive and quite possibly unique is its side-scrolling SHUMP features. I\u2019ve played plenty of visual novels that blend JRPG or tactics mechanics, but this might be the first time I\u2019ve had some R-Type mixed in with my VN.<\/p>\n<p><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.digitallydownloaded.net\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/03\/ss_78eb8da81e9d25aa7c337f423c07a2bd44ac89fa.jpg\" alt=\"A screenshot from Kamikaze Lassplanes\" width=\"1920\" height=\"1080\" \/><\/p>\n<p>This was an interesting challenge that the developers set themselves, for several reasons. Firstly, SHMUPs are famous for offering big, twitch energy action, while visual novels are more quiet and sedate. Asking people to jump from one to another is a big ask, thematically and in terms of general pacing. Secondly, SHMUPs are well known for being very difficult and I\u2019m not sure people pick up a visual novel because they want to be put in a mood where they want to throw their console at the wall. Kamikaze Lassplanes\u2019 SHMUP sections don\u2019t hold back, either, especially with the bosses.<\/p>\n<p>Both sides of this particular coin are developed well for their particular genres. The visual novel section is paced well and generally well-written, though it needed a good editor to come through to polish it for typos and grammatical issues. The SHMUP section has all the bullet hell dodging, power-ups, and enemy patterns to remember. I just personally don\u2019t think these two genres are compatible with one another. JRPGs and tactics RPGs make sense as \u201cgameplay partners\u201d to VNs because those, too, are not action-based systems. Asking players to bounce between challenging action combat and sedate reading is, unfortunately, going to exclude large numbers of the potential audience that don\u2019t care for one or the other of these very contrasting genres. Especially when the game has a habit of just throwing you into a SHMUP section with very little warning.<\/p>\n<p>Still, it\u2019s hard to criticise the game when, if you do fall into the middle bit of the Venn diagram (\u201cLikes hardcore SHMUP\u201d and \u201cLikes fanservicey VN\u201d) then the developers have basically delivered everything you could hope for. A 10-hour story mode, with a full arcade mode as a bonus. Gorgeous artwork, featuring two gorgeous women, ecchi and all. Even when you look past the women (if you can), the effort that has gone into the art, be that VN or action sequences, pushes well beyond what you\u2019d expect from an indie project. This is a good, honest project, in other words, and the developers were fully committed to delivering to their vision.<\/p>\n<p><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.digitallydownloaded.net\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/03\/ss_73bbbeffbd68759f0322f5fd0fef1049867f2c70.jpg\" alt=\"A screenshot from Kamikaze Lassplanes\" width=\"2560\" height=\"1440\" \/><\/p>\n<p>I\u2019m not the world\u2019s biggest SHMUP fan, and I\u2019m not great at the genre, so I struggled to get through Kamikaze Lassplanes.
